Why Should Clinics Go Paperless?
- Improved Access: Digital records are easier to retrieve, share, and analyze—helping faster decisions.
- Reduced Errors: EHRs reduce mistakes in prescriptions and documentation.
- Time Savings: Digitized workflows save up to 20% of clinicians’ time (HealthIT.gov).
- Environmental Benefit: Clinics waste over 10,000 paper sheets annually—easily reduced with digital tools.
Steps to Transition to a Fully Digital Clinic
- Assess Your Workflow: Identify paper-heavy areas like patient intake, billing, prescriptions.
- Invest in the Right Technology: Use integrated Practice Management Software like HealthOK.
- Digitize Patient Records: Start scanning legacy files and adopt structured templates for new entries.
- Automate Routine Tasks: Use automated systems for appointment reminders, follow-ups, etc.
- Train Your Staff: Offer onboarding and continuous support for smooth adoption.
- Monitor & Optimize: Use dashboards to track usage and adoption across departments.
